ESG as part of the due diligence  process is an increasingly important aspect of real estate investment and development, particularly in light of recent legislative moves such as SFDR and increased rules on energy efficiency. If properly structured it can help investors and developers identify and mitigate risks, enhance sustainability, and improve the overall performance of a project. Positive ESG credentials of a building or project are  also playing an increasing role in boosting rental yields and valuations.

There are several key steps involved in intertwining ESG themes within the normal ,due diligence process effectively. When defining the scope of any due diligence questionnaire  you should at first determine what specific ESG issues are material to the project or building in question, and in what sections of the normal DD they should fall. Energy efficiency, water conservation, waste management, and social impact should all be high on the list. Background information such as public records, environmental assessments, building certificates or pre-assessments and previous stakeholder consultations also make good starting points, but what should you consider after that?

  1. Identify what data you require and where to find it. Along with being accurate it should also be granular, up to date and relevant to building or portfolio at hand. 
  2. Analyse and assess the data: this will tell you how a building operates, where resources are wasted and show up inefficiencies. At this point you should be able to identify any potential risks or opportunities related to ESG issues too.
  3. Develop a plan to mitigate the risks  and capitalise on any long term ESG opportunities. This may involve implementing specific measures or strategies, such as planning to install energy-efficient systems or engaging in stakeholder consultation. You can start to look at the cost of these remedial measures and plan properly.
  4. Monitor and report on progress: considerations for how you go about doing this should be part of the DD process too. In the event you decide to proceed, this will need to be done on an ongoing basis and is crucial to ensure that the project remains on track to meet its ESG goals and objectives over time. This may involve setting additional targets, using benchmarks to track progress, and regularly report on such actions to stakeholders.

Robust ESG due diligence processes and subsequent pre-planning will serve you well and also ensure you go into an investment or project with most potential ESG risks, remedial measures (and opportunities) already identified. Given the wave of legislation, particularly when it comes to financing projects or investing in real estate projects, it essential you have this well covered or the economic and reputational costs to you could be substantial.
